Antique Victorian Gold Filled Horseshoe Paste Locket / ca. 1900s

$125.00
Sold Out

Antique Victorian gold filled round locket by R.B. MacDonald company, founded in 1874 in Attleboro, Massachusetts. The locket features a bright horseshoe motif decorated with white paste rhinestones. The locket measures 1-3/8” x 1-3/8” , and it has a bail to hang it on a chain.

The piece is in good condition for its age, with some scuffs, scratches are tarnish (see photos). It is in otherwise great condition, and securely closes with a snap. It does not include plastic inserts to hold photos.

The inside of the locket features a bumble bee stamp, the date 1874, the letters "RBM" on the top, and the letters "ATRICE" on the bottom. The combination of letters and the image of the bee stand for “Beatrice”. R.B. MacDonald company manufactured a collection of these “Little Beatrice” lockets, named after the maker's daughter, from 1904-1924.
